Important Bills in the House of Commons
House of Commons is set to rise on June 23, 2023. With one week planned as a constituency week, that leaves only 9 expected sitting weeks until the summer break on Parliament Hill. When I say summer break, I don’t mean the Members are going to take the summer off. I am sure there will be some vacation plans with family but summertime is spent in their respective constituencies.

House of Commons passes C-11 and sends it back to the Senate.
Bill C-11 is the proposed “Online Streaming Act” in Canada. It has been sent back to the Senate for further review as of March 30, 2023.

Public Inquiry of Foreign Election Interference
On Thursday March 23, 2023, Members of Parliament voted in favour of a public inquiry into foreign election interference. The motion, brought by NDP leader, Jagmeet Singh, was supported 172 to 149.

Chinese Interference?
In the recent news, there have been leaks regarding the interference of the People’s Party of China on our federal elections. These disclosures were brought to us via Canada’s mainstream media from CSIS whistleblowers. Both CSIS and the RCMP are investigating these leaks for possible violations of the Security of Information Act. Canadians would like to see an investigation into the actual allegations of foreign interference.

CSIS Documents Reveal Chinese Strategy to Influence Canada's 2021 Election
It is now established that there was a co-ordinated effort by the Chinese government to influence the last federal election in September 2021. CSIS determined that China wanted to see Prime Minister Trudeau win a minority government. However, CSIS director said that there is no evidence that Chinese manipulation resulted in the election of any MP.
